HERBED TUNA SALAD



Herbed Tuna Salad image

"Cooking for two is such a challenge for us, since my husband and I do not care for leftovers," says Rebecca Schweizer of Chesapeake, Virginia. "This well-seasoned salad, with its distinctive dill flavor, is my favorite lunch recipe.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Lunch

Time 15m

Yield 2 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 can (6 ounces) light water-packed tuna, drained and flaked
2 tablespoons finely chopped red onion
1 teaspoon minced fresh parsley
1-1/2 teaspoons dill weed
1/8 teaspoon garlic salt
1/8 teaspoon dried thyme
1/8 teaspoon pepper
Pinch cayenne pepper
2 tablespoons fat-free mayonnaise
1 tablespoon reduced-fat sour cream
3 cups Boston lettuce leaves
6 grape tomatoes, sliced
Optional: sliced cucumber and fresh dill

Steps:

  • In a small bowl, combine the first eight ingredients. Combine the mayonnaise and sour cream; stir into the tuna mixture. , Divide the salad greens between two plates. Top with tuna mixture and tomatoes and if desired, cucumbers and dill.

TUNA SALAD WITH HERB TOAST



Tuna Salad with Herb Toast image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     main-dish

Time 20m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

6 tablespoons mayonnaise
1/2 cup chopped fresh basil and/or chives
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
4 thick slices crusty bread
2 tablespoons red wine vinegar
1 head romaine lettuce, shredded
1 English cucumber, chopped
1 15-ounce can chickpeas, drained and rinsed
1 pint cherry tomatoes, halved
2 stalks celery, chopped
3 tablespoons chopped pickles or cornichons
2 5-ounce cans solid white tuna in water, drained

Steps:

  • Preheat the broiler. Whisk the mayonnaise, herbs and 1/2 teaspoon each salt and pepper in a large bowl. Spread 1/2 tablespoon of the herbed mayonnaise on each slice of bread; transfer to a baking sheet. Broil until the bread is lightly toasted, about 2 minutes.
  • Whisk the vinegar into the remaining herbed mayonnaise. Add the lettuce, cucumber, chickpeas, tomatoes, celery, pickles and tuna and toss to combine; season with salt and pepper. Divide among plates and serve with the toast.

SUMMERY HERBED TUNA PASTA SALAD



Summery Herbed Tuna Pasta Salad image

Marry tuna, pasta, green beans and carrots with an herby white wine vinaigrette.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 45m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1/3 cup olive oil
2 tablespoons white wine vinegar
1 small shallot, minced
1 cup trimmed, chopped green beans
8 ounces dried farfalle
One 5-ounce can solid white tuna, preferably packed in olive oil, drained
1/2 cup torn fresh basil leaves
1/2 cup shredded carrots
1/4 cup thinly sliced celery
1/4 cup thinly sliced fresh chives
2 medium vine-ripe tomatoes, chopped

Steps:

  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il.
  • Whisk together the olive oil, vinegar, shallot, 1/2 teaspoon salt and a few grinds of pepper in a large bowl.
  • Cook the green beans in the boiling water until crisp-tender, 3 to 4 minutes. Transfer the beans to a colander with a slotted spoon and run under cold water to stop the cooking process. Add them to the bowl with the dressing.
  • Add the pasta to the boiling water and cook according to the package directions. Drain and rinse under cold water to cool; add to the bowl.
  • Add the tuna, basil, carrots, celery, chives and tomatoes to the bowl and toss to combine. Season with salt and pepper. The pasta salad is best if served right away.

TUNA SALAD WITH FRESH HERBS



Tuna Salad With Fresh Herbs image

A simple, light, summer lunch. Tuna enhanced by the first, fresh herbs from the garden. My 7yo has been helping me in the garden this year and he was thrilled to be taught how to pick the dill.

Provided by 3KillerBs

Categories     Lunch/Snacks

Time 10m

Yield 6-8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

4 (6 ounce) cans tuna in water, well-drained
3 stalks celery
6 sprigs fresh dill (about 3-4 inches each)
6 sprigs fresh parsley (about 3-4 inches each)
2 tablespoons sweet onions, minced
1/4 cup lemon juice
4 tablespoons mayonnaise
1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il
1/2 teaspoon salt (to taste)
fresh ground black pepper

Steps:

  • Chop the celery and the herbs.
  • Mix all ingredients together in a small bowl.
  • Serve as wraps, sandwiches, or with crackers. I suggest using multi-grain bread and lettuce.
  • If you like creamier tuna salad feel free to double the mayo.

FRESH HERB TUNA SALAD



Fresh Herb Tuna Salad image

This is adapted from the tuna salad at Noah's Bagels. The dill and green onion add a fresh herby flavor, the celery adds a satisfying crunch and the minimal amount of mayo makes this much more like a salad than the tuna goo normally presented as "tuna salad." It's quite good in a sandwich (or bagel!) as well - it helps to use your hand or an ice cream scoop to compress the salad onto the bread.

Provided by op_tic_nerve

Categories     Lunch/Snacks

Time 7m

Yield 4-6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

12 ounces canned albacore tuna in water
2 stalks celery, chopped
2 green onions, chopped
4 sprigs dill, chopped
3 ounces mayonnaise
salt and pepper

Steps:

  • Combine ingredients in a bowl and serve!
